Improving the reliability of GPC/SEC results
On-line light scattering and viscometer detectors increase the information depth of GPC/SEC data and allow absolute molar masses and structures to be measured. Find out how to improve the reliability of GPC/SEC light-scattering and viscometry results. More...
Agilent Technologies supports proteomics research
Agilent Technologies has announced that Steven Carr, PhD, director of the Proteomics Platform at the Broad Institute of MIT and Harvard, has been selected for an Agilent Thought Leader award supporting his work developing new technology for analysing proteins and peptides. More...

Tosoh Bioscience celebrates 40 years of SEC/GPC expertise
The development of the first TSKgel GPC column in 1971 had set the course for a long and proud history of size exclusion chromatography at Tosoh. Read more
